How Hard Water Affects Your Plumbing
Tough water, a common concern in numerous homes, can have substantial influence on pipes systems. Understanding these effects is vital for maintaining the durability and efficiency of your pipelines and fixtures.

Intro


Hard water is water which contains high levels of dissolved minerals, mainly calcium and magnesium. These minerals are safe to human wellness but can wreak havoc on plumbing facilities over time. Allow's look into exactly how difficult water impacts pipelines and what you can do concerning it.

What is Hard Water?


Hard water is characterized by its mineral web content, specifically calcium and magnesium ions. These minerals go into the supply of water as it percolates via limestone and chalk deposits underground. When difficult water is heated or delegated stand, it often tends to develop scale, a crusty build-up that adheres to surfaces and can trigger a series of problems in plumbing systems.

Influence on Pipeline


Hard water impacts pipelines in a number of harmful methods, primarily via range build-up, lowered water circulation, and raised rust.

Range Build-up


Among one of the most typical problems caused by difficult water is scale build-up inside pipelines and components. As water moves with the pipes system, minerals speed up out and adhere to the pipeline wall surfaces. With time, this accumulation can narrow pipeline openings, leading to reduced water circulation and enhanced pressure on the system.

Lowered Water Circulation


Mineral deposits from tough water can slowly lower the size of pipes, restricting water circulation to taps, showers, and appliances. This decreased circulation not just impacts water stress however additionally boosts power usage as appliances like water heaters have to function more difficult to provide the same quantity of warm water.

Corrosion


While tough water minerals themselves do not cause corrosion, they can aggravate existing deterioration issues in pipelines. Range buildup can catch water against metal surface areas, speeding up the rust process and potentially bring about leakages or pipe failing in time.

Device Damages


Past pipelines, difficult water can additionally harm household appliances connected to the water supply. Appliances such as hot water heater, dishwashing machines, and washing devices are particularly prone to range buildup. This can lower their performance, rise upkeep expenses, and shorten their life-span.

Expenses of Hard Water


The financial implications of tough water expand beyond pipes fixings to consist of raised energy expenses and premature appliance substitute.

Repair Costs


Dealing with hard water-related issues can be pricey, specifically if range accumulation brings about pipeline or device failure. Regular upkeep and early detection of troubles can assist alleviate these costs.

Power Efficiency


Range build-up reduces the effectiveness of water heaters and other home appliances, bring about greater power intake. By addressing difficult water issues promptly, homeowners can enhance power effectiveness and decrease energy costs.

Testing and Treatment


Evaluating for tough water and implementing appropriate treatment measures is vital to reducing its effects on pipelines and appliances.

Water Conditioners


Water softeners are one of the most typical remedy for treating tough water. They work by trading calcium and magnesium ions with sodium or potassium ions, efficiently lowering the solidity of the water.

Other Therapy Alternatives


Along with water softeners, other therapy options include magnetic water conditioners, reverse osmosis systems, and chemical ingredients. Each approach has its benefits and suitability relying on the severity of the tough water problem and household demands.

Preventive Measures


Stopping hard water damages calls for a mix of aggressive maintenance and thoughtful fixture choice.

Routine Upkeep


Consistently purging the plumbing system and examining for range build-up can help avoid expensive repair work down the line. Routine checks of home appliances for indicators of range build-up are also important.

Choosing the Right Fixtures


Selecting plumbing fixtures and devices designed to hold up against difficult water conditions can alleviate its impacts. Search for products with corrosion-resistant materials and easy-clean functions to minimize upkeep needs.

Verdict


In conclusion, the influences of hard water on pipes and devices are considerable yet workable with appropriate recognition and preventive measures. By understanding just how hard water impacts your pipes system and taking proactive steps to mitigate its impacts, you can prolong the life of your pipelines, enhance energy effectiveness, and minimize maintenance prices in the long run.

The Impact of Hard water on Your Plumbing and Appliances


One of the most common issues associated with hard water is scale buildup. Scale is a hard, crusty deposit that forms on the inside of pipes and plumbing fixtures due to the minerals in hard water. Over time, these deposits can accumulate and cause a range of problems for your plumbing system.



How scale buildup affects plumbing and water pressure



As scale continues to accumulate inside your pipes, it narrows the passage through which water can flow. This makes it increasingly difficult for water to pass through, leading to a number of problems that can affect your home’s plumbing system.



Slow drains are a common issue associated with scale buildup. As the pipe diameter narrows, water has a harder time draining, which can result in slow-moving drains and even standing water in sinks and bathtubs.



Reduced water pressure in showers and faucets is another consequence of scale accumulation. As the buildup restricts water flow, less water is able to pass through your pipes at any given time. This leads to weak water pressure in your showers and faucets, making everyday tasks like washing your hands or taking a shower less enjoyable and effective.



Clogged pipes are perhaps the most severe problem that can arise from scale buildup. In extreme cases, the accumulated scale can completely obstruct the passage of water through the pipe, resulting in a total blockage. This can cause backups in your plumbing system, potentially leading to costly repairs and even water damage to your home.


Corrosion and damage to fixtures



The minerals present in hard water, primarily calcium and magnesium, can react with metal surfaces, causing a variety of problems that can impact the performance and appearance of your fixtures.



One of the primary ways that hard water causes damage to fixtures is through the formation of rust and other types of corrosion. When the minerals in hard water come into contact with metal surfaces, they can react chemically, leading to the formation of rust, tarnish, or other corrosive substances. This not only affects the appearance of the fixtures, causing discoloration and staining, but can also weaken the fixtures over time.



Furthermore, the constant exposure to hard water can cause seals and washers within your fixtures to wear out more quickly, potentially leading to leaks and other malfunctions. As these components become worn or damaged, they may no longer provide an effective seal, allowing water to leak out around the edges of the fixture, potentially causing water damage to surrounding areas.



Hard water can have a significant impact on your plumbing fixtures, causing corrosion, damage, and reduced functionality. By addressing hard water issues in your home, you can help to protect your fixtures from these problems, ensuring they remain functional and visually appealing for years to come.



The Impact of Hard Water on Appliances



Reduced efficiency and lifespan




Hard water can have a significant impact on the efficiency and lifespan of your appliances. The scale buildup caused by hard water can clog or damage various components, leading to decreased performance and increased energy consumption. Appliances that use water, such as dishwashers, washing machines, and water heaters, are particularly susceptible to hard water damage.



The lifespan of your appliances can also be shortened by hard water. Scale buildup can cause increased wear and tear on components, leading to more frequent breakdowns and a shorter overall lifespan. By addressing hard water issues, you can help to extend the life of your appliances and save money on repairs and replacements.



Dishwashers and hard water



Dishwashers are especially vulnerable to the effects of hard water. Scale buildup can cause poor water circulation, leading to dishes that are not properly cleaned. Additionally, the minerals in hard water can leave unsightly spots and streaks on glassware and other dishes. Regular maintenance and the use of water softeners can help to mitigate these issues and keep your dishwasher running smoothly. Learn how to clean and maintain your dishwasher.



Washing machines and hard water



Hard water can also impact the performance of your washing machine. Scale buildup can clog the water inlet valve, leading to reduced water flow and decreased cleaning efficiency. Hard water can also cause detergent to be less effective, resulting in dingy, stiff, and scratchy clothing. By addressing hard water issues, you can ensure that your washing machine continues to provide optimal performance and extend its lifespan.



Water heaters and hard water



Water heaters are particularly susceptible to the negative effects of hard water, as they are in constant contact with water and have internal components that can be damaged by scale buildup. The accumulation of scale inside the water heater can lead to reduced efficiency, higher energy bills, and decreased hot water availability. Moreover, scale buildup can cause increased wear on the heating element, shortening its lifespan and potentially leading to costly repairs or replacements.



One of the key components within a water heater that is particularly vulnerable to hard water damage is the anode rod. The anode rod is a sacrificial component designed to corrode in place of the water heater’s tank, thereby extending its life. However, hard water can cause the anode rod to corrode more quickly than intended, leading to a decreased lifespan for both the rod and the water heater as a whole. Regular inspection and replacement of the anode rod can help ensure that it continues to protect your water heater from corrosion.



To protect your water heater from the damaging effects of hard water, it is important to implement regular maintenance procedures and consider using water softeners. Regular maintenance, such as flushing the water heater to remove sediment and scale buildup, can help maintain its efficiency and prolong its lifespan. This process involves draining the water from the tank and flushing it with fresh water to remove any accumulated sediment and scale
